WHO ARE WE LOOKING FOR

We’re currently looking for an Expert Graphic Designer to contribute to the Women’s vision for Nike Sportswear Apparel. Our team works on highly visible product in Women’s Sportswear Apparel on a global scale. Our lead candidates must be able to effortlessly navigate a broad range of insight and influence in the Women’s apparel market. Distilling this cultural and consumer information to create best-in-class graphic narratives that inspire and surprise our consumer.

This role requires a high level of passion and creativity, along with the versatility and focus to contribute to graphic direction and strategy through the product creation process. It takes a dedicated leader and teammate that knows how to collaborate and translate sophisticated insights into authentic narratives, while driving design solutions that elevate the future of Sportswear apparel at Nike.

WHAT WILL YOU WORK ON

Groundbreaking, innovative Nike design. Concepting and building out narratives that will inspire and influence our Sportswear consumer. To accomplish this, you will collaborate with your design, development and business partners to ensure all details are recorded and delivered as presented. From Trims to print applications and cost considerations you will be challenged by a wide range of responsibilities and experiences.

Accountabilities include but are not limited to, influencing teams, speaking with athletes* and contributing to the creative vision of Nike Women’s Sportswear apparel. Leading team meetings and cascading critical information to ensure the project hits all deadlines. Presenting design concepts and seasonal initiatives to internal and external audiences while always keeping to Nike’s best interests.

WHO WILL YOU WORK WITH

You will be driving graphic strategy and vision while working with multiple teams of designers, developers, and product managers to deliver creative in line with the Nike Design Ethos. This opportunity will require strong collaborative skills to meet deadlines, ensure feasibility of designs, hit price points, while talking your partners through the thinking behind your work.

WHAT YOU WILL BRING

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Graphic Design, 5 years or more of graphic design experience at agency or in-house setting, or equivalent combination of relevant education, experience, and training.
  • Passion and understanding of current and emerging design trends and visual culture.
  • Master at translating insights into authentic narratives and visual storytelling.
  • Ability to adapt to change and handle multiple, competing priorities.
  • Master visual and verbal communication skills, able to effectively present design intent to internal and external audiences.
  • Master of design craft, innovation, graphic applications, prints, processes and tools.
  • Master of apparel product creation.
  • Digital design acumen in Adobe CC and comfortable working within Digital tools/3D
  • Ability to embrace diverse points of view while fostering an environment of inclusivity.
